## Runbook: Autocomplete Index Degradation

If Sablewick typeahead exceeds 300ms p95 post-release, assume index fragmentation. Do not roll back; rebuild instead. Run `sable idx rebuild --warm` and wait for shard convergence (~15 min). Plugin-supplied suggesters are loaded after convergence; if yours fails to load, check analyzer compatibility first. Rebuilt indexes won't serve traffic until the manifest passes signature verification. Plugin authors shipping custom suggesters must co-sign their manifests. Verification uses the key below.

release key, kahif-yagap: bky3_1JN

// Max lines the Foghorn log-tailing CLI pulls per request. Support folks:
// don't crank this up to "see more context" — anything past this makes the
// tail lag badly on the Mirebrook cluster and you'll get paged about it.
// Use the paging flag instead. This limit was settled after the build
// referenced below.

trace token, kahog-hadup: htk9_337a55b4e

TURN-208: Gatevale turnstile counters at the Merrow Field pilot double-count when a rotation reverses mid-cycle. Attendance totals drift roughly 2% high per event. The debounce window fix is implemented, reviewed by Ilsa, and soak-tested across two simulated match days without drift. Ready for your cut; the candidate build is identified below.

trace token, tagag-tafog: htk6_5ed18c